Output 80f018c9c24c948440187e66796f4c4f1d671349899342da237aaafe282cdc86:0

value
652327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b188bace3d1bbfbed3ab8478a8091d484721b139 OP_EQUALVERIFY OP_CHECKSIG
address
1HBiQ6quihfr9y7Dc2j8DnkRTqNBzri8T3
transaction
80f018c9c24c948440187e66796f4c4f1d671349899342da237aaafe282cdc86
confirmations
442088
spent
true